Spain's 50MW biomass power plant connected to the grid: reduces 187,000 tons of CO2 annually and creates over 400 jobs
【Crypto World】A major European energy company has officially connected its biomass power generation project in the Caceres region of Spain to the grid. This 50 MW power plant can generate 380 GWh of electricity annually, which can reduce over 187,000 tons of CO2 emissions—equivalent to the carbon emissions of tens of thousands of cars in a year.
More interestingly, what practical impact does this project have? The power plant consumes 275,000 tons of biomass each year, mainly from forestry residues, which not only clears forest waste and reduces fire hazards but also stimulates the local forestry economy. During construction, it directly created over 400 jobs, and ongoing maintenance can provide about 30 long-term positions.
The project uses a 20-year fixed-price contract, a stable business model that remains attractive in the energy sector. From carbon reduction and employment stimulation to ecological optimization, such projects are becoming benchmarks for Europe’s energy transition.
